6 Reasons Why Specialized Training Matters in Sex Therapy and Couples Therapy
Specialized training plays a crucial role in the fields of sex therapy and couples therapy, providing therapists with the knowledge and skills necessary to address the unique challenges and complexities of these areas effectively. Whether helping individuals navigate their sexual concerns or guiding couples through relationship difficulties, specialized training ensures that therapists are equipped with the expertise and competence needed to provide high-quality care. Here’s why specialized training matters in sex therapy and couples therapy.
Reason Number One Why Specialized Training Matters in Sex Therapy and Couples Therapy: In-Depth Knowledge
Specialized training provides therapists with a deep understanding of the specific issues and dynamics involved in sex therapy and couples therapy. They acquire comprehensive knowledge about human sexuality, sexual functioning, relationship dynamics, communication patterns, and intimacy. This specialized knowledge allows therapists to recognize and address the intricacies of sexual and relational concerns that may not be adequately understood by professionals without specific training in these areas.

Reason Number Two: Evidence-Based Approaches
Specialized training equips therapists with evidence-based therapeutic approaches and interventions that have been proven effective in addressing sexual and relational difficulties. They learn various therapeutic modalities and techniques tailored specifically for sex therapy and couples therapy. This enables therapists to employ strategies that have a solid foundation in research and clinical practice, increasing the likelihood of positive outcomes for their clients.
Reason Number Three: Understanding Diverse Needs
Specialized training fosters a deep appreciation for the diverse needs of clients seeking sex therapy and couples therapy. Therapists learn about the unique experiences and challenges faced by individuals and couples from different backgrounds, including diverse cultural, ethnic, and LGBTQ+ populations. This training helps therapists develop cultural competence, sensitivity, and awareness, enabling them to provide inclusive and affirming care to clients with diverse identities and experiences.
Reason Number Four: Addressing Sexual Concerns
Sex therapy requires therapists to address sensitive and personal topics related to human sexuality. Specialized training allows therapists to navigate discussions around sexual desire, arousal, performance, sexual dysfunction, sexual orientation, gender identity, and more with expertise and sensitivity. They learn to create a safe and non-judgmental space for clients to explore their sexual concerns and develop healthy attitudes toward their sexuality.
Reason Number Five: Relationship Dynamics
Couples therapy involves working with couples to improve their communication, resolve conflicts, strengthen emotional bonds, and enhance overall relationship satisfaction. Specialized training in couples therapy equips therapists with a deep understanding of relationship dynamics, attachment theory, and effective strategies for promoting healthy and fulfilling partnerships. They learn to navigate power dynamics, improve communication skills, foster emotional intimacy, and address specific issues that couples may face.
Reason Number Six: Ethical Considerations
Specialized training emphasizes the ethical considerations and professional guidelines specific to sex therapy and couples therapy. Therapists learn about maintaining confidentiality, managing boundaries, addressing countertransference, and handling sensitive topics in an ethical manner. This training ensures that therapists uphold the highest ethical standards when working with clients, promoting trust, safety, and professionalism.
